centos7mysql主从复制(默认异步)
admin
2023-02-26 10:41:53
0

一主一从

 本文用的是 yum install -y mariadb  安装
配置MySQL复制基本步骤:
一、**master**
1、启用二进制日子,选择一个唯一server-id

centos7mysql主从复制(默认异步)
2、创建具有复制权限的用户
进入mysql
MariaDB [(none)]>GRANT REPLICATION SLAVE ON . TO 'mysql141'@'192.168.137.153' IDENTIFIED BY '123456'; #创建用户mysql141 ip地址指向从服务器 密码为123456
3.测试创建的用户连接性
退出mysql,然后输入以下命令看是否能进入,密码123456
[root@localhost ~]#mysql -umysql141 -p
如果报错:mysql 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: YES)
解决方法:vi /etc/my.cnf 添加 skip-grant-tables
centos7mysql主从复制(默认异步)

二、slave
1、启用中继日志,选择一个唯一的server-id
relay-log = relay-log
server-id =
centos7mysql主从复制(默认异步)
2、连接至主服务器,并开始复制数据;
进入MySQL:
mysql> CHANGE MASTER TO master_host = '主服务器',master_user = 'mysql141',master_password = '123456',master_log_file = 'mysql-log.000010',master_log_pos = 480;

mysql> start slave #开启下面两个状态为YES
mysql>SHOW SLAVE STATUS \G; #查看状态
Slave_IO_Running: Yes
Slave_SQL_Running: Yes

当看到Slave_IO_State:Waiting for master ot send event 、Slave_IO_Running: YES、Slave_SQL_Running: YES才表明状态正常。

注意:
master_log_file = 'mysql-log.000010' #在主服务器用show master status;查看
master_log_pos = 480 #在主服务器用show master status;查看

三、测试主从复制是否成功
在主服务器上创建数据库
SHOW DATABASES; #查看当前的数据库
CREATE DATABASE haha; #创建数据库haha

在从服务器上查看
SHOW DATABASES; #查看数据库是否有haha这个数据库

如果有haha这个库,说明你已经成功了!

相关内容

热门资讯

今日重磅消息“阳光巴厘岛.辅助... 有 亲,根据资深记者爆料阳光巴厘岛是可以开挂的,确实有挂(咨询软件无需打...
【今日要闻】“乐友棋牌.是不是... 【今日要闻】“乐友棋牌.是不是有挂?”太坑了果然有挂您好,乐友棋牌这个游戏其实有挂的,确实是有挂的,...
终于了解“快乐打筒子.怎么装挂... 有 亲,根据资深记者爆料快乐打筒子是可以开挂的,确实有挂(咨询软件无需打...
玩家最新攻略“琼戏互娱.究竟有... 您好:琼戏互娱这款游戏可以开挂,确实是有挂的,需要了解加客服微信【4282891】很多玩家在这款游戏...
终于了解“新九方炸金花.开挂器... 有 亲,根据资深记者爆料新九方炸金花是可以开挂的,确实有挂(咨询软件无需...
最新引进“新蓝鲸.到底有挂吗?... 有 亲,根据资深记者爆料新蓝鲸是可以开挂的,确实有挂(咨询软件无需打开直...
玩家攻略科普“中至上饶麻将.真... 您好:中至上饶麻将这款游戏可以开挂,确实是有挂的,需要了解加客服微信【9784099】很多玩家在这款...
【今日要闻】“花城牌舍.可以开... 有 亲,根据资深记者爆料花城牌舍是可以开挂的,确实有挂(咨询软件无需打开...
乌代表团与美欧举行系列会议,美... 当地时间12月21日,美国总统特使威特科夫表示,过去三天,乌克兰代表团在美国佛罗里达州与美国和欧洲伙...
终于懂了“新青鸟牛牛.怎么装挂... 您好:新青鸟牛牛这款游戏可以开挂,确实是有挂的,需要了解加客服微信【9752949】很多玩家在这款游...